Can Steroid Inhalers Worsen Asthma Symptoms?

Asthma is a chronic respiratory condition characterized by inflammation and narrowing of the airways, leading to symptoms such as coughing, wheezing, and breathlessness. Steroid inhalers, also known as corticosteroid inhalers, are a common treatment option for managing asthma symptoms and reducing inflammation in the airways.

However, there is some concern that steroid inhalers may worsen asthma symptoms in some individuals. Let’s explore this topic further to gain a better understanding.

Explanation of the Use of Steroid Inhalers for Asthma Treatment

Steroid inhalers work by delivering corticosteroids directly to the airways, where they help reduce inflammation and prevent asthma attacks. They are considered a key component of asthma management and are typically used as a preventive or maintenance therapy.

These inhalers are different from rescue inhalers, which contain short-acting bronchodilators that provide quick relief during asthma attacks.

Possible Side Effects of Steroid Inhalers

Like any medication, steroid inhalers can have potential side effects. However, the side effects associated with steroid inhalers are generally considered to be minimal compared to the potential benefits they provide in controlling asthma symptoms and reducing the risk of exacerbations.

Common side effects of steroid inhalers include:

  • Sore throat
  • Hoarseness
  • Oral thrush (a fungal infection in the mouth)
  • Cough
  • Headache

These side effects can be minimized by using proper inhaler technique and rinsing the mouth after each use.

Factors that may contribute to steroid inhalers worsening asthma

Proper inhaler technique and usage

One of the key factors that can impact the effectiveness of steroid inhalers in asthma management is the proper technique and usage of these devices. It is important for individuals to receive proper education and training from healthcare professionals on how to use their inhalers correctly, as improper technique can lead to inadequate medication delivery to the lungs. This can result in suboptimal control of asthma symptoms and potentially worsen the condition.

The role of smoking and tobacco use in asthma management

Smoking and tobacco use can significantly worsen asthma symptoms and reduce the effectiveness of medication treatments, including steroid inhalers. Smoking irritates the airways, making them more sensitive and prone to inflammation. It can also interfere with the function of lung cells and reduce the response to medication therapy. Therefore, it is crucial for individuals with asthma who smoke to quit smoking and avoid exposure to secondhand smoke in order to optimize asthma control and the benefits of steroid inhalers.

Strategies to help smokers quit and improve asthma control

Quitting smoking is crucial for managing asthma effectively. Smoking cessation can lead to improved lung function and reduced asthma symptoms. Here are some strategies that can help smokers quit and improve their asthma control:

  • Medication: Nicotine replacement therapy (NRT) products, such as nicotine patches or gums, can help reduce nicotine cravings and increase the chances of quitting smoking. Prescription medications, such as bupropion or varenicline, can also be effective.
  • Behavioral support: Counseling, support groups, and behavioral therapy can provide smokers with the tools and techniques to cope with cravings and develop healthier habits.
  • Lifestyle changes: Engaging in regular physical activity, avoiding triggers such as secondhand smoke, and finding healthy coping mechanisms for stress can all contribute to better asthma control.

It is important for smokers with asthma to work closely with their healthcare providers to develop a personalized asthma management plan. This plan should include regular follow-up appointments to monitor asthma control, adjust medication as needed, and provide ongoing support for smoking cessation.

Can Pharmacists Prescribe Asthma Inhalers?

Pharmacists play a crucial role in the management and treatment of asthma. They are highly knowledgeable about medications and can provide valuable guidance to patients. However, the ability of pharmacists to prescribe asthma inhalers varies depending on the country and jurisdiction.

1. Role of Pharmacists in Asthma Management

Pharmacists are healthcare professionals who specialize in the safe and effective use of medications. In the context of asthma, they can provide education on proper inhaler technique, help patients develop an asthma action plan, and assist in the selection of appropriate inhalers. Pharmacists also play a role in monitoring medication adherence and identifying any potential drug interactions.

2. Pharmacist Prescribing Privileges in the United States

In the United States, the ability of pharmacists to prescribe asthma inhalers varies from state to state. As of now, there are several states that have granted limited prescribing privileges to pharmacists for certain conditions, including asthma. These privileges allow pharmacists to prescribe medications within a specific scope of practice and under certain conditions.

Can Pulmicort be used with long-acting inhalers to treat asthma?

Pulmicort is a commonly used steroid inhaler for the management of asthma. It contains the active ingredient budesonide, which helps to reduce inflammation in the airways and improve symptoms. Long-acting inhalers, on the other hand, are designed to provide ongoing relief and control of asthma symptoms throughout the day.

It is possible to use Pulmicort with long-acting inhalers to treat asthma, and this combination therapy can be particularly beneficial for individuals with moderate to severe asthma who require additional control. By combining the anti-inflammatory effects of Pulmicort with the prolonged bronchodilator effects of long-acting inhalers, patients may experience improved asthma control and a reduction in exacerbations.

Research studies have shown that the use of combination therapy, such as Pulmicort with long-acting inhalers like Symbicort or Advair, can lead to better asthma control and a reduction in hospitalizations and emergency room visits. It is important to note that the combination of these medications should be done under the guidance of a healthcare professional, who can assess the individual patient’s needs and response to therapy.

Can preventer inhalers make asthma worse?

Preventer inhalers are a vital part of managing asthma, but there is a common misconception that they can actually make asthma symptoms worse. It is important to understand how preventer inhalers work and the potential side effects they may have.

Explanation of preventer inhalers in asthma management:

Preventer inhalers, also known as controller inhalers, are used on a daily basis to control inflammation and reduce the risk of asthma attacks. They contain corticosteroids, which help to reduce swelling and mucus production in the airways, making breathing easier. Preventer inhalers are typically used long-term to keep asthma symptoms under control and prevent flare-ups.

See also  The Combivent Journey: Steps to Buy Online, Transition from MDI to Respimat, Alternatives, and More

Common side effects of preventer inhalers:

While preventer inhalers are generally safe and effective, they can have some potential side effects. The most common side effects include:

  • Hoarseness or a hoarse voice
  • Thrush or oral yeast infections
  • Coughing
  • Irritation of the throat

It is important to note that these side effects are usually mild and temporary, and they can often be minimized by using proper inhaler technique and rinsing the mouth after each use.
